Below are the free 10 sample questions. Question 1: A new product has no similar items on which to base a forecast. Which approach is a temporary solution for supply planning? A. Consider a simulation of the supply plan ’ s calculated safety stock. B. Consider safety stock based on a days - of - cover calculation. C. There is no temporary solution. D. Use safety stock as demand, until enough shipment history is available. Answer: D Explanation: The correct solution: Use safety stock as demand, until enough shipment history is available. Here‘s why this is the best temporary approach for supply planning with a new product with no similar items: Safety Stock as Demand: By treating your desired safety stock level as the initial demand forecast, you ensure adequate inventory on hand to meet potential fluctuations in real demand. This buffer helps prevent stockouts and production disruptions during the early stages. No Historical Data: Since you lack historical sales data for the new product, using it directly for forecasting would be unreliable and likely result in inaccurate inventory planning. Temporary Solution: This approach is appropriate until you gather sufficient actual sales data on the new product. Over time, you can refine your forecasts based on this data and transition to more sophisticated forecasting methods. The other options are less suitable: Simulation of Safety Stock: This can be complex and resource - intensive without reliable input data. Days - of - Cover Calculation: This estimates safety stock based on existing product lines, which won‘t be relevant for a completely new product. No Temporary Solution: Avoiding any planning altogether would be risky and potentially lead to stockouts. Question 2: Your Manufacturing Organization makes bicycles and ships 50% of its output directly to large chain retailer customers. Your organization also ships products to your Distribution Center so that it can fulfill many other smaller customers. Your Manufacturing Organizations uses Oracle SCM Planning Cloud, but your Distribution Center does not. Which setups should you recommend to the Manufacturing Organization? A. Map the Distribution Center as a customer in Maintain Supply Network Model; Select ‘include transfer orders‘ in Edit Plan Options. B. In Edit Plan Options, ensure both organizations are included in plan scope, and select, ‘include transfer orders‘. C. Select ‘include transfer orders‘ in Edit Plan Options‘ advanced supply options. D. Map the Manufacturing Organization as a supplier in Maintain Supply Network Model; Select ‘Include transfer orders‘ in Edit Plan Options. Answer: A Explanation: The most appropriate setup recommendation for the Manufacturing Organization: 1. Map the Distribution Center as a customer in Maintain Supply Network Model; Select ‘include transfer orders‘ in Edit Plan Options. Here‘s why this option effectively addresses the scenario: Customer mapping: Since the Distribution Center receives finished goods from the Manufacturing Organization, defining it as a customer within the supply network model accurately reflects the flow of materials. Transfer orders included: Selecting “include transfer orders“ in Edit Plan Options ensures that the planning process considers the internal movement of goods from the Manufacturing Organization to the Distribution Center. This facilitates accurate supply planning and avoids double - counting inventory. The other options are less optimal because they either miss crucial aspects or involve unnecessary configurations: In Edit Plan Options, ensure both organizations are included in plan scope, and select ‘include transfer orders‘: While accurate in including both organizations and transfer orders, explicitly mapping the Distribution Center as a customer provides clearer visibility and simplifies future updates to the supply network model. Select ‘include transfer orders‘ in Edit Plan Options‘ advanced supply options: Including transfer orders is necessary, but specifying the advanced options might be unnecessary in this simple two - organization scenario. Map the Manufacturing Organization as a supplier in Maintain Supply Network Model; Select ‘Include transfer orders‘ in Edit Plan Options: Defining the Manufacturing Organization as a supplier to its own Distribution Center wouldn‘t accurately reflect the internal relationship and might lead to confusions in the network model. Question 4 : How can you deliver a forecast for drop shipments? A. Excel upload using File Based Data Import Process B. Generate manually using Planning Analytics C. Create based on the supplier performance for drop shipment collection D. It cannot be done at this time. E. Create based on the drop shipment or booking history; the ship from will be the drop ship validation organization Answer: E Explanation: Drop shipment history: Utilizing historical data of confirmed drop shipments or bookings provides a reliable foundation for forecasting future demand. Analyzing trends and seasonality within this data can reveal valuable insights to predict upcoming requirements. Drop ship validation organization: When creating the forecast, it‘s essential to specify the “ship from“ organization as the drop ship validation organization. This organization acts as the central point for collecting and managing drop shipment information within your system. By focusing on this organization, you ensure the forecast accurately reflects the expected drop shipment activity. The other options are less suitable for forecasting drop shipments: Excel upload: While you can upload forecast data through File Based Data Import, it wouldn‘t leverage the specific context of drop shipments and require manual preparation of data outside the system. Planning Analytics: This tool provides powerful analytical capabilities, but it wouldn‘t directly generate forecasts on its own. You would still need to utilize historical data or specific forecasting methods within Planning Analytics to achieve a drop shipment forecast. Supplier performance: While supplier performance might influence drop shipment lead times, it wouldn‘t directly substitute for forecasting actual demand requirements. It cannot be done at this time: Drop shipment forecasting is indeed possible within Oracle Cloud Supply Chain Planning. Question 5 : You want to understand what your inventory turns are for your organization. Where can you see this information in Planning Central? A. Manage Planning Analytics B. Plan Summary C. Manage Metrics D. View Planning Analytics E. Manage Planning Measures Answer: B Explanation: Manage Planning Analytics: While Planning Analytics offers extensive data analysis capabilities, it requires you to create specific calculations or reports to visualize inventory turns. You wouldn‘t directly find pre - populated information about inventory turns within this area. Manage Metrics: This section allows you to define and manage custom metrics within the system, but it wouldn‘t necessarily contain pre - populated inventory turn data unless you‘ve explicitly created a custom metric for this purpose. View Planning Analytics: Similar to Manage Planning Analytics, this option leads to a broader analytical environment where you would need to configure dashboards or reports to visualize inventory turns. Manage Planning Measures: Similar to Manage Metrics, this section focuses on defining and managing specific calculations for data analysis, and wouldn‘t readily display pre - calculated inventory turn values. Plan Summary, on the other hand, provides a convenient overview of key performance indicators for your plan, including pre - calculated values for various metrics like inventory turns. Typically, you‘ll find inventory turns displayed as a ratio or a number representing the average number of times your inventory has been sold and replaced within a specific period (e.g., year, quarter, month).
